Transaction e9cbc63cc881a21cd7d114b492c5f60630abb34f126b72a1ba6b39f50dd8b71a

2 Input
2 Outputs
  • e9cbc63cc881a21cd7d114b492c5f60630abb34f126b72a1ba6b39f50dd8b71a:0
  • value  975690
    address  1oYuRDxZM6aeiB74sL7pAddFSrWpxYPzg
  • e9cbc63cc881a21cd7d114b492c5f60630abb34f126b72a1ba6b39f50dd8b71a:1
  • value  5000000
    address  14Tw712ZNzQrSgMPd8gU2c8HvfzaFYkWSu